Plumbing Maintenance Engineer 35-40k Call out and Overtime available OTE 45k+
M4 Corridor

Are you a Plumber or Plumbing Maintenance Engineer working with Water Treatment / Hygiene and keen to expand on your experience in this field.
This Bristol based Water Treatment Company specialise in the commercial property sector working with a number of Mechanical / HVAC companies that require specialist water treatment services.

They are now recruiting an Engineer to working along the M4 Corridor due to a new contract being awarded.

As Water Treatment / Water Hygiene Engineer you will be responsible for carrying out works to a portfolio of sites across the M4 Corridor with sites from Bristol to London with occasional trips a little further a field.

Duties will include carrying Water Treatment and Hygiene tasks such as System Flushing, Legionella testing, Temperature monitoring, system chlorination and tank cleaning as well as general plumbing duties

The successful individuals will be working under the supervision and guidance of our Operational management team to help deliver and maintain continual growth and compliance.

The successful candidate will need the following:

  • To be able to work well in a team and the ability to work on their own initiative.
  • Have previous knowledge in the water treatment or water hygiene industry, knowledge of BISRA would be advantageous .
  • Comfortable with travel and working at multiple sites daily.
  • The ability to carry out some plumbing tasks.
  • Have good communication skills and a professional manner at all times.
  • A clean driving UK driving licence.
  • Legionella Risk Assessment qualified is desirable but not essential.

The successful candidate will be rewarded with the following:

  • A company vehicle with company fuel card.
  • A competitive rate of pay with the opportunity of overtime.
  • Overtime paid at premium rate.
  • Company uniform and PPE supplied.
  • Basic tools and training provided.
